Vaping
If you're seeking quick effects and a stronger buzz, vaping has the highest bioavailability compared to other Delta 8 THC consumption methods. Inhaling Delta 8 THC through vaping allows it to quickly enter the bloodstream via the lung tissue, resulting in almost immediate effects. Tinctures
Delta 8 THC tinctures are administered by placing them under the tongue. This method allows the majority of the compound to enter the bloodstream through the mucous membrane in the mouth, bypassing the digestive system. To ensure maximum absorption, it is recommended to hold the tincture under the tongue for up to a minute before swallowing the remaining liquid. However, it's worth noting that Delta 8 THC tinctures may take longer to take effect than CBD tinctures, and the reason for this delay is still being researched. Generally, users can expect to feel the effects of Delta 8 THC tinctures within 45 minutes to an hour of administration.
Edibles
Delta 8 THC can be consumed through fruity gummies that offer a precise dose per serving, eliminating the need for additional measurements. These edibles are available in a variety of flavors and are a popular choice for those who are picky about taste. Delta 8 THC gummies have a longer-lasting effect compared to tinctures and vapes. However, they may take up to 1-2 hours to take effect due to delayed onset.
Capsules
Delta 8 THC capsules, like other herbal products, are available in capsule form. They are administered orally, similar to gummies, and take up to 2 hours to take effect after being swallowed with water. The effects can last up to 10 hours. The advantage of Delta 8 THC capsules is that they are odorless and tasteless, unlike the harsh aftertaste that comes with delta 8 distillate. Topicals
Topical cannabis products include items such as balms, creams, salves, lotions, and transdermal patches that are applied directly to the skin. These products are commonly used for localized application and surface-level interaction with the body. When applied topically, cannabinoids do not typically enter the bloodstream in significant amounts. Instead, they interact with cannabinoid receptors found in the skin’s endocannabinoid system, which plays a role in maintaining balance within the skin’s natural processes. Because of this limited absorption, traditional topical products are not associated with intoxicating effects.
